MySQL出现:ERROR2003(HY000):Can'tconnecttoMySQLserveron'localhost:3306'(10061)问题。

遇到MySQL连接问题:ERROR2003(HY000):无法连接到localhost'localhost:3306'(10061)。
解决步骤如下:首先,验证本地MySQL服务器是否已安装。
如果安装成功,在命令行中输入“mysqld--install”以确认基础环境已准备就绪。
然后,我尝试启动服务器并输入“netstartmysql”,但失败了。
您可能会遇到启动失败和提示,阻止您继续下一步。
在这种情况下,尝试初始操作。
运行“mysqld--initialize-insecure”,然后再次运行“netstartmysql”。
此时,仍然存在连接问题,但注意到您无需密码即可登录,这可能是临时权限设置。
确保安全;需要更改密码。
以MySQL8为例,使用“mysql>ALTERUSER'root'@'localhost'IDENTIFIEDBY'333';”将密码更改为'333';(这里的密码是一个例子,实际使用自定义密码)和“flushprivileges;”来重置权限。
输入完成密码修改后,尝试再次输入新密码进行连接。
您应该能够成功登录MySQL服务器。
如果问题还没有解决。
您可能需要再次检查网络设置或MySQL服务的配置。

MySQL_ERROR2003_可执行文件路径错误的解决方法

遇到MySQL输入路径错误尝试移动安装文件后,MySQL服务无法启动,麻烦了一段时间。
更深入的调查显示,尽管调整了环境变量和my.ini文件,但服务属性中可执行文件的路径并未更新。
关键在于注册表中的配置。
在注册表中找到了与MySQL相关的关键值,并通过修改imagepath值,正确设置了MySQL服务路径。
修改完成后,进入services.msc服务管理界面,找到MySQL服务,点击启动,服务运行成功。
根据经验,对于类似的路径配置错误,应首先检查注册表中的相应条目,确保配置正确。
调整环境变量和my.ini文件是有用的工具如果服务属性中的路径没有改变,编辑注册表是解决路径问题的关键。

MySQL错误200310060"Unknownerror"

如果本地使用Navicat连接阿里云Ubuntu1804MySQL5.7数据库时出现2003-Can'tconnecttoMysqlserveron"xxx"(10060"Unknownerror")错误,可以按照以下步骤修复。
为了解决这个问题,我们首先需要允许root用户远程连接MySQL服务器。
为此,请运行以下命令:GRANTALLPRIVILEGESON*.*TO'root'@'%'IDENTIFIEDBY'yourpassword'WITHGRANTOPTION;请将“yourpassword”替换为您的数据库密码。
这将授予root用户从任何主机访问数据库的权限。
为了确保更改立即生效,下一步是更新权限。
运行以下命令完成更新过程:FLUSHPRIVILEGES;然后关闭数据库连接,并运行以下命令打开防火墙端口3306以允许外部连接:sudoufwallow3306;然后重新启动防火墙以确保设置生效:sudoserviceufwrestart;最后,检查防火墙规则是否设置正确,并确保端口3306已打开:sudoufwstatus;如果命令显示允许端口3306,则问题应该得到解决。
再次尝试连接MySQL数据库。
这样问题就不会再出现了。

MySQLERROR2003(HY000)

安装MySQL5.5客户端后,连接需要出错。
我在百度上搜了一下,最重要的mysql服务是保证激活的。
在百度上尝试了各种方法,都未能解决问题。
我怀疑端口问题导致了失败。
如果是端口问题,我应该为TCP或UDP、出站或入站添加3306。

'

2003MySQL报错排查与解决2003mysql报错

2003MySQL错误:故障排除和故障排除MySQL是一种开源关系数据库软件,广泛应用于Web应用程序、数据分析、存储和其他环境中。
然而MySQL在使用过程中会遇到各种各样的问题,其中最常见的就是2003错误。
本文介绍MySQL2003错误的原因、故障排除和解决方案。
2003MySQL错误的原因2003MySQL错误表示无法连接MySQL服务器,部分原因如下:1.在连接MySQL服务器之前,需要确保MySQL服务器存在。
初始化,否则将引发2003错误。
2.无法到达的IP地址或端口号:需要指定正确的IP地址和端口号才能连接MySQL服务器,如果IP地址或端口号无法到达MySQL服务器,也会给出2003错误。
3.防火墙或路由器阻止MySQL连接:防火墙或路由器可能会阻止MySQL连接,此时需要打开相关端口或将MySQL添加到白名单。
2003MySQL故障排除方法我们需要使用telnet工具来判断MySQL服务器是否可达。
部分步骤如下:1.打开命令提示符并输入TelnetIP地址的端口号,例如telnet127.0.0.133062.如果可以连接到MySQL服务器,将显示以下信息:正在尝试127.0.0.1…连接到127.0.0.1。
转义字符是'^]'。
不允许主机连接。
他的MySQL服务器连接被外国主机关闭。
3。
如果无法连接MySQL服务器,会出现如下信息:ConnectingTo127.0.0.1...Connectedtothehost,onport3306:Connected根据telnet结果,可以检测到2003MySQL错误。
如果连接MySQL服务器成功,则说明MySQL服务器已启动,且IP地址和端口号正确。
解决2003MySQL错误的方法,我们可以采取以下步骤:1.确保MySQL服务器已启动:systemctlstatusmysql地址和端口号是否正确。
开放端口3306:sudoufwallow3306/tcp42003MySQL错误是MySQL连接问题,会影响数据读取和存储。
这篇文章有误从三个方面介绍了原因、故障排除和解决方案,并提供了具体的指导方针,供读者参考。
我希望它对任何使用MySQL时遇到问题的人有用。